
Navodaya Vidyalaya Schools in Aluva, Kerala
Navodaya Vidyalayas are set up in rural parts of India. These schools get full funding from the Government of India, although the management lies with Navodaya Vidyalaya Samiti, which operates under the Ministry of Human Resource Development. These schools took birth in 1986 to uplift the students of poorer sections of society. Education in Navodaya Vidyalayas is free to all, however, they take a nominal fee of Rs 200 from the students of class 9th to 12th. Students of SC/ST or girl students get an exemption from the fee.
